中文摘要
IFN是先天免疫以及机体抵抗病毒感染第一道防线中最重要的细胞因子。目前,IFN依然是临床治疗多种病毒感染疾病的常规疗法。近年来,随着人们物质生活的极大丰富,糖尿病患病率急剧增加,糖尿病患者中IFN抗病毒治疗效果不佳。重要的是,在糖尿病人和动物模型中糖基化水平明显增高;然而,糖基化修饰与IFN介导的抗病毒功能的研究尚未有报道。本项目在前期的研究中发现糖基转移酶OGT能够与STAT1结合,显著抑制IFN信号通路,降低IFN介导的抗病毒效率。在此基础上,本项目拟深入探讨糖基转移酶OGT对STAT1的糖基化修饰;进一步,明确糖基化修饰对IFN信号通路和抗病毒功能的影响;最终通过敲基因小鼠研究糖基化修饰对体内抗病毒反应的影响。本项目通过探索糖基化修饰调控IFN抗病毒信号的新机制,旨在为临床抗病毒治疗提供潜在的分子靶标。
英文摘要
IFN is the most important cytokine in innate immunity and the first line of defense against viral infection. At present, IFN is still a routine therapy for the treatment of a variety of viral infections in clinical. In recent years, as people's material life is greatly enriched, the prevalence of diabetes has increased sharply, and IFN antiviral therapy is not effective in diabetics. Importantly, the O-GlcNAcylation levels are significantly increased in diabetics and animal models; however, it has not been reported about the relevance between O-GlcNAcylation modification and IFN-mediated antiviral function. Our preliminary datas showed that the glycosyltransferase OGT interacted with STAT1 and significantly inhibited IFN signaling pathway, which reduced IFN-based antiviral therapy efficacy. Based on a series of our preliminary datas, we plan to explore STAT1 O-GlcNAcylation modification by OGT. Further, we will study the mechanisms by which OGT regulates IFN signaling pathway and IFN-mediated antiviral function. Finally, we intend to clarify the influence of antiviral function by O-GlcNAcylation modification through knockout mice. This project focuses on studying the new mechanisms by which protein O-GlcNAcylation modification regulates IFN antiviral signaling and function, and aims to provide potential therapeutic targets for antiviral therapy.
IFN是先天免疫以及机体抵抗病毒感染第一道防线中最重要的细胞因子。目前,IFN依然是临床治疗多种病毒感染疾病的常规疗法。提高IFN抗病毒效率具有重要的临床价值。蛋白翻译后修饰对蛋白功能和信号传递息息相关。然而,目前糖基化修饰与IFN抗病毒效率的研究尚未有报道。在该项目中,我们着重探究了STAT1糖基化修饰对IFN信号的调控机制,明确了糖基化修饰的关键靶点和作用机制,并且筛选出能够通过调控STAT1糖基化修饰进而调控IFN抗病毒的小分子物质。在项目执行过程中,我们明确了糖基转移酶OGT能够促进IFN信号通路活化,进而促进了IFN介导的抗病毒功能。进一步,我们鉴定了OGT作用IFN通路的关键靶点为STAT1蛋白,并且OGT能够促进STAT1 T699发生糖基化修饰。此外,我们阐明了STAT1糖基化修饰调控IFN信号的具体机制,STAT1糖基化修饰能够促进其与IFNAR2的结合。最后,我们通过筛选小分子物质,发现果糖能够通过STAT1糖基化修饰在体内调控IFN信号和抗病毒活性。本项目通过探索糖基化修饰调控IFN抗病毒信号的新机制,最终为临床抗病毒治疗提供潜在的分子靶标。
